I have a question about my 98 F-150. When i start the engine it seems as though my fan clutch is fully ingaged and the fan is spinning at the same RPM as the motor. The higher i rev the higher the fan speed gets and it NEVER shuts off. Could this just be a bad fan clutch or is there a more serious problem i am overlooking?
